Degradation phenomena in Praseodymium Oxide-based Zinc Oxide varistor ceramics derived-through modified citrate technique
Current trend shows that Pr6O11 based ZnO ceramics are actively researched to overcome drawbacks in Bi2O3 based varistor materials.
